,可以通过数据库的联结(join)操作来实现。联结操作是将两个或多个表中的记录按照某个条件进行匹配,从而得到满足条件的记录集合。
具体步骤如下:
- 确定需要联结的两个表,假设为表A和表B。
- 确定联结条件,即表A和表B之间的关联字段。例如,假设表A的关联字段为A_id,表B的关联字段为B_id。
- 使用联结操作,将表A和表B联结起来,并根据关联字段进行匹配。常见的联结操作有内联结(inner join)、左联结(left join)、右联结(right join)等,根据具体需求选择适当的联结方式。
- 根据联结结果,获取存在的所有记录。
以下是一些相关名词的概念、分类、优势、应用场景、推荐的腾讯云相关产品和产品介绍链接地址:
- 数据库联结(Join):
- 概念:数据库联结是将两个或多个表中的记录按照某个条件进行匹配,从而得到满足条件的记录集合。
- 分类:内联结(inner join)、左联结(left join)、右联结(right join)等。
- 优势:可以通过联结操作获取多个表中的相关数据,方便进行数据分析和查询。
- 应用场景:多表关联查询、数据分析、报表生成等。
- 腾讯云产品推荐:腾讯云数据库 TencentDB(https://cloud.tencent.com/product/tencentdb)
- 关联字段(Join Key):
- 概念:关联字段是两个表之间用于进行联结操作的字段,通常是具有相同含义或关系的字段。
- 分类:主键(Primary Key)、外键(Foreign Key)等。
- 优势:通过关联字段可以建立表与表之间的关系,方便进行数据的联结操作。
- 应用场景:多表关联查询、数据关系建立等。
- 腾讯云产品推荐:腾讯云数据库 TencentDB(https://cloud.tencent.com/product/tencentdb)
- 内联结(Inner Join):
- 概念:内联结是根据联结条件获取两个表中满足条件的记录集合。
- 优势:可以获取两个表中共同存在的记录,过滤掉不满足条件的记录。
- 应用场景:需要获取两个表中共同存在的记录。
- 腾讯云产品推荐:腾讯云数据库 TencentDB(https://cloud.tencent.com/product/tencentdb)
- 左联结(Left Join):
- 概念:左联结是根据联结条件获取左表中的所有记录,并将右表中满足条件的记录进行匹配。
- 优势:可以获取左表中的所有记录,即使右表中没有匹配的记录。
- 应用场景:需要获取左表中的所有记录,并匹配右表中满足条件的记录。
- 腾讯云产品推荐:腾讯云数据库 TencentDB(https://cloud.tencent.com/product/tencentdb)
- 右联结(Right Join):
- 概念:右联结是根据联结条件获取右表中的所有记录,并将左表中满足条件的记录进行匹配。
- 优势:可以获取右表中的所有记录,即使左表中没有匹配的记录。
- 应用场景:需要获取右表中的所有记录,并匹配左表中满足条件的记录。
- 腾讯云产品推荐:腾讯云数据库 TencentDB(https://cloud.tencent.com/product/tencentdb)
请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和情况进行评估。